I spent three weeks in Ghana and this was my second trip with PMGY (after first going to India in 2014). The UK team are fantastic at replying to queries and I cannot fault them at all.

I had a wonderful time in Ghana, and I would definitely recommend it to younger or more nervous travellers, as I can honestly say I felt safe 100% of the time, and was happy to travel around Kumasi alone without any problems. Seth and Cobbinah are extremely helpful and will organise hotels, trips and taxis for you if you choose to do any excursions of your own. Sophia and Adjua are genuinely great cooks which makes the change in diet much easier to get used to! The orphange project is challenging but very rewarding, and there is plenty of opportunity for you to organise your own activities if you bring the stuff you need - be that colouring, crafts, football/rounders or even a trip to the swimming pool.

I went on the Cape Coast trip which was an absolutely fantastic weekend - the range of activities from the poignancy of the Cape Coast museum to the opportunity to learn to surf made the weekend really good value, and some of the places we visited were genuinely the nicest places I've ever been able to see.

I'd recommend PMGY to anyone looking to travel and volunteer - they are great value for money and provide an excellent service. Sadly I'm running out of time to do anything like this again, but if I ever am feeling adventurous, I'll be heading straight to PMGY!
